‘A Life Changing Life’ stars real care and support workers and the people they support.

COVID-19 has put the spotlight on care for the vulnerable in the community and this is echoed in the federal Department of Social Services' campaign for care and support workers, via M&C Saatchi Melbourne.

The campaign, A Life Changing Life, shows the bond between workers and the people they support. In the personal story of Mandy and Elizabeth, aged-care worker Mandy explains how Elizabeth has changed her life:

"Every day she lives life to the fullest."

The campaign aims to boost the carer and support workforce, for people with disabilities, older people and veterans. It will be rolled out onto television, OOH, digital and social media, backed by the campaign hub - careandsupportjobs.gov.au - which contains resources for stakeholders, employers and communities.

Emma Robbins, Executive Creative Director at M&C Saatchi Melbourne, says: “This has been an incredibly important, inspiring campaign for our team to work on. The strength and character of the people we've met and featured, and the value of the relationships they share together will work to raise awareness about how rewarding, mutually beneficial and ultimately life changing a job in the sector can be.”
